> > > > On Wed, Jul 11, 2018 at 12:23:10AM +0800, Robin Gong wrote:
> > > > > Add MEMCPY support, meanwhile, add SDMA_BD_MAX_CNT instead of
> > > > > '0xffff'.
> > > > >
> > > > > Signed-off-by: Robin Gong <yibin.gong@xxxxxxx>
> > > > > ---
> > > > > +static struct dma_async_tx_descriptor *sdma_prep_memcpy(
> > > > > +		struct dma_chan *chan, dma_addr_t dma_dst,
> > > > > +		dma_addr_t dma_src, size_t len, unsigned long flags) {
> > > > > +	struct sdma_channel *sdmac = to_sdma_chan(chan);
> > > > > +	struct sdma_engine *sdma = sdmac->sdma;
> > > > > +	int channel = sdmac->channel;
> > > > > +	size_t count;
> > > > > +	int i = 0, param;
> > > > > +	struct sdma_buffer_descriptor *bd;
> > > > > +	struct sdma_desc *desc;
> > > > > +
> > > > > +	if (!chan || !len)
> > > > > +		return NULL;
> > > > > +
> > > > > +	dev_dbg(sdma->dev, "memcpy: %pad->%pad, len=%zu,
> > channel=%d.\n",
> > > > > +		&dma_src, &dma_dst, len, channel);
> > > > > +
> > > > > +	desc = sdma_transfer_init(sdmac, DMA_MEM_TO_MEM, len /
> > > > SDMA_BD_MAX_CNT
> > > > > +					+ 1);
> > > > > +	if (!desc)
> > > > > +		goto err_out;
> > > > > +
> > > > > +	do {
> > > > > +		count = min_t(size_t, len, SDMA_BD_MAX_CNT);
> > > >
> > > > When len is bigger than 0xffff you initialize count to 0xffff...
> > > In this case, the data will be split into several bds, for example, If
> > > the total count is 0x10000, two bd used then. One is for 0xffff,
> > > Another is for the last 1
> > 
> > And you are doing byte size DMA? Wouldn't word size accesses be more
> > optimal?
> > 
> > Sascha
> Default is words, and I'll force the buswidth to word and set into BD.
> sdma->dma_device.copy_align = DMAENGINE_ALIGN_4_BYTES;

So guess which alignment the second transfer has when the first has the
size 0xffff.

Sascha
